Some countries have more than one local name, and for some countries the 
Lojban name is not made by spelling the local name in Lojban letters.

Nagorno-Karabakh has several local languages. The "Karabakh" part (which means 
"black garden") is nearly invariable, but the "Nagorno" part appears as 
"Leṙnayin" in Armenian, "Nagornyy" in Russian, and "Dağlıq" in Azeri. In 
Lojban I call it "la poi ma'azva .karabáx.".

East Timor is Timor Leste in Portuguese and Timór Lorosa'e in Tetum. This 
would be "la .sun.timór." in Lojban. The Portuguese name is also used in other 
languages. How to Lojbanize it depends on what Portuguese accent you pick. It 
could be "la .timór.lest.", "la .timór.lect.", or "la .timór.lectc.". What to 
do with the consonant cluster at the end, I'm not sure. "lectic" maybe?

Belarus is "la .blabruk." from pre-dotside days. Under dotside, "la .bélarus." 
is also valid.

Myanmar was "la .mianmar." until the CGV initial was abolished. That makes it 
"la .mranmar." reflecting the spelling. (Rangoon was respelled Yangon for the 
same reason. The letter corresponding to ર is now pronounced /j/.) The brivla 
form cannot be "mranma" because that's a slinku'i. I suggest "amranma". The 
final 'r' is an artifact of rhotic and non-rhotic dialects of English.

Countries that have a gismu have a cmene based on it. Usually it has "-gug" 
appended, but Egypt is just "la .misr.". "la .frans." appears in a poem in 
Alice, but "la .fasygug." is also in use. (The corpus is down.)
